If after considering the circumstances of their dismissal, and the information contained on this website, an employee still believes that they have been unfairly dismissed, employees are able to lodge an application for reinstatement with either the Queensland Industrial Relations Commission (state) or the Australian Industrial Relations Commission (federal). Applications must be lodged within twenty-one (21) days of the date of termination. Determining which Commission you lodge your application with is dependent upon whether you are covered under the state or federal jurisdiction. However, in special circumstances extensions may be granted on application to the Commission. A union can also apply to the Commission on behalf of the employee.
